/eg-zek'/ <operating system> 1. execute.
A synonym for
chain derived from the
Unix "exec"
system call.
Unix manual page: execve(2).
2. (Obsolete)
executive.
The mainstream "exec" as an abbreviation for (human) executive
is *not* used. To a hacker, an "exec" is a always a program,
never a person.
3. At
IBM and
VM/
CMS shops, the equivalent of a
shell
command file.
4. <operating system> The innermost
kernel of the
Amiga
operating system which provides shared-library support,
device interface,
memory management,
CPU management, basic
IPC, and the basic structures for OS extension. The rest of
the Amiga OS (windowing, file system, third-party extensions,
etc.) is built using these structures.
